Italian word
sensuale
sensual (relating to the senses, especially sexual)
Looks like
sensual
relating to physical, especially sexual, pleasure
⚠️ The trap
True cognate but Italian 'sensuale' has a stronger overtly sexual connotation than the English 'sensual' which can also describe food or music pleasures. Use with awareness of register.
To say "relating to physical, especially sexual, pleasure" in Italian:
sensuale (true cognate — but register is more explicit in Italian)
"sensuale" in English means:
sensual (relating to the senses, especially sexual)
Example
"La danza era molto sensuale."
"The dance was very sensual."
